DONALD Trump said it is virtually impossible to set up a meeting between Putin and Zelensky as his efforts continue to be frustrated.

Zelensky has said he is ready and willing to meet – but the Kremlin confirmed today there is nothing in the diary.

Trump said: “We’re going to see if Putin and Zelensky will be working together.

“You know, it’s like oil and vinegar, a little bit. They don’t get along too well, for obvious reasons.”

Trump added “we’ll see” if he would need to attend any such meeting.

The US President has said since Monday’s White House meeting that he is working on setting up a meeting.

After four days of heavy diplomacy he sounded optimistic – and there was widespread hope of momentum towards peace.

Trump took a 40-minute call from Putin in the middle of his meeting with European leaders – then said the wheels were in motion, and a location just needed to be picked.

A plan was sketched out for the Russian and Ukrainian leaders to meet – potentially followed by a trilateral summit with Trump also at the table.

But Sergey Lavrov, Putin’s top goon, confirmed on Friday there are no plans for a head-to-head between Putin and Zelensky.

As the week has gone on, there has been minimal sign from Putin that he actually wants to meet Zelensky – and his ruthless demands of Ukraine have not changed.

Fears are growing that Trump’s Alaska meeting with Putin was fruitless – and that it in fact gave the dictator exactly what he wanted.

Kaja Kallas, the EU’s top diplomat, warned on Friday that Putin is laying a trap for the West by demanding to keep hold of Ukrainian land.

He also still wants to starve Ukraine of Western boots on the ground, ban the country from ever joining NATO and cap the size of its army, Kremlin sources revealed.
